Flurl http test
WebSep 10, 2024 · Mystery solved: As it turns out after some debugging with Wireshark, the website was returning HTTP status code 301. As explained here the default action is to follow the URI in the response's location header using a GET even if the original request was a POST. Share Improve this answer Follow answered Sep 10, 2024 at 17:27 … WebHttpTest.Settings (configured test settings always "win") Available properties are mostly the same at all 4 levels, with a few exceptions. Here's a complete list along with where they are and are not supported: Note that only the absence of explicitly setting a value signals to inherit from up the hierarchy. null means null, not inherit.
Flurl http test
Did you know?
WebJan 29, 2024 · See the follwoing test cases where we compare a barebone .NET core HttpClient with Flurl for a situation where we have a server that respond ONLY to http2 over non secure transport using FluentAssertions; using Flurl; using Flurl.Http; u... WebJan 29, 2024 · using FluentAssertions; using Flurl; using Flurl.Http; using Flurl.Http.Configuration; using System; using System.Net.Http; using …
WebJan 1, 2024 · Type with 0 fields and 11 methods WebSep 4, 2024 · Flurl also has its own mechanisms for testing, so writing complicated mocks and test cases has become a non-issue. We’ll get to that later on. Since Flurl is …
WebAug 16, 2016 · using System.IO; using Flurl; using Flurl.Http; namespace ConsoleApplication { public class Program { public static void Main (string [] args) { var fs = File.OpenRead ("some_file"); var response = "http://target-host.com" .AppendPathSegment ("some/endpoint") .PostMultipartAsync (mp => mp .AddString ("some-label", "value") … WebAug 4, 2024 · An alternative approach to testing HttpClient calls without service wrappers, mocks, or IoC containers is to use Flurl, a small wrapper library around HttpClient that provides (among other things) some robust testing features. [Disclaimer: I'm the author] Here's what your controller would look like.
WebDec 19, 2024 · Flurl reuses the same HttpClient instance per host by default, so configuring this way means that every call to theapi.com will allow the use of the untrusted cert.
WebFor simple logging and debugging, FlurlHttpException.Message gives you a handy summary of the error, including the URL, HTTP verb, and status code received. FlurlHttpException also gives you a few shortcuts for deserializing the body: These are all short-hand for equivalent methods on FlurlHttpException.Call.Response, so you can go that route ... circa 1969 jensen beach flWebReport this post Report Report. Back Submit dialysis school near meWeb如何使用jq在字符串中漂亮地打印JSON?,json,jq,pretty-print,Json,Jq,Pretty Print,我正在用jq编写一个更复杂的转换,我想做的一件事是在字符串中有一个漂亮的打印JSON。 dialysis school in flWebAirflow 中文文档:使用测试模式配置,Airflow具有一组固定的“测试模式”配置选项。您可以随时通过调用airflow.configuration.load_test_config()来加载它们(注意此操作不可逆!)。但是,在您有机会调用load_test_config()之前,会加载一些选项(如DAG_FOLDER)。为了急切加载测试配置,请在airflow.cfg中设置test ... circa 1850 wood bleach home depotWebNov 15, 2024 · HttpRequestMessage.Content is a read-once, forward-only stream that has already been read and disposed by the time you're accessing it. To assert the captured string body, you would typically just do this instead: httpTest.ShouldHaveCalled (url) ... . WithRequestBody (content) EDIT As you noted, this doesn't work based on how you're … dialysis school onlineWebMay 23, 2024 · Thanks for your quick reply. I am using using Flurl.Http.Signed latest version-1.1.2 which only available on NuGet package Manager. When server is unavailable due to VPN disconnection then only unhandled exception occours. I need only how to handle it without any crash. – circa 1850 heavy body paint \\u0026 varnish removerWebJan 1, 2024 · Type with 1 fields and 3 methods 表示 [GET] /v1/bot/test 接口的请求。 dialysis school in ny